Output bdfc27ca1cc2cbda16d96547ba716d9300016183ded730f00f2bfe072c977037:21

value
25008462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f9119125b194ba6e579d7f5bab6cc44f3c5ef7 OP_EQUAL
address
MCTPiRNgSqsyVUQZpdz5BH495JFjjQRrv5
transaction
bdfc27ca1cc2cbda16d96547ba716d9300016183ded730f00f2bfe072c977037
spent
true